Vue CLI 和自己主要区别虽然能打造出独一无二的家选择和配置测试框架
Vue CLI 和自己配置的主要区别
Vue CLI 和自己手动配置项目,其实就像是买现成家具和定制家具的区别。Vue CLI 简直就是给你一套装修好的房子,而自己配置就像是从零开始搭建一个家。
一、简化配置过程
Vue CLI 就像是一个快速通道,它能让你在几分钟内就能拥有一个功能齐全的 Vue 项目。而自己配置,就像是拿着工具自己去装修,虽然能打造出独一无二的家,但过程可能复杂且容易出错。
Vue CLI | 自己配置 |
---|---|
使用命令行工具快速生成项目。 | 手动安装和配置各种依赖,如 Webpack、Babel 等。 |
提供交互式配置选项。 | 编写和调试配置文件。 |
内置默认配置。 | 可能需要查阅大量文档和教程。 |
二、内置功能和插件
Vue CLI 已经给你准备好了各种家具,从沙发到衣柜,一应俱全。而自己配置,就像是去家具城挑选每一件家具,虽然可以完全按照自己的喜好来,但需要更多的时间和精力。
Vue CLI 内置功能 | 自己配置 |
---|---|
Vue Router 和 Vuex 的集成。 | 手动集成 Vue Router 和 Vuex。 |
单元测试和端到端测试的支持。 | 选择和配置测试框架。 |
PWA 配置。 | 手动配置 Service Worker 和相关文件。 |
ESLint 和 Prettier 等代码质量工具。 | 配置 ESLint 和 Prettier。 |
三、更新和维护
Vue CLI 会定期给你家具做保养,保持它们的新鲜和美观。而自己配置的家,需要你自己去维护和更新。
Vue CLI 更新 | 自己配置 |
---|---|
提供命令,自动检查并升级依赖。 | 手动检查和更新各类依赖包。 |
插件和依赖由官方维护。 | 需要关注各个依赖的更新日志和兼容性问题。 |
四、社区支持
Vue CLI 有一个强大的社区,就像是你的邻居,有问题可以随时请教。而自己配置的家,你可能需要自己解决各种问题。
Vue CLI 社区支持 | 自己配置 |
---|---|
官方文档详尽。 | 需要查阅不同依赖的文档。 |
庞大的社区和论坛。 | 问题解决可能需要更多时间和精力。 |
丰富的第三方插件和工具。 | 定制化需求可能较难找到现成的解决方案。 |
五、灵活性和控制权
Vue CLI 给你的是一个标准化的家,而自己配置,就像是你的梦想家园,你可以根据自己的需求来定制。
Vue CLI | 自己配置 |
---|---|
适合大多数常见项目需求。 | 完全自主选择和配置各类依赖和工具。 |
配置简单快捷。 | 更高的灵活性。 |
六、性能优化
Vue CLI 会为你提供一些性能优化的方案,就像是为你安装了节能设备。而自己配置,就像是自己去研究节能方法。
Vue CLI | 自己配置 |
---|---|
默认配置中包含性能优化方案。 | 需要手动配置性能优化方案。 |
提供构建时性能分析工具。 | 需要具备一定的性能优化经验。 |
七、总结和建议
总的来说,Vue CLI 和自己配置各有优劣,就像家具一样,看你需要哪种风格。新手和中小型项目推荐用 Vue CLI,因为它简单快捷。而对于有特定需求或高级用户,自己配置可能更合适。
建议:
- 新手和中小型项目:推荐使用 Vue CLI。
- 高级用户和大型项目:可以考虑自己配置。
通过权衡以上因素,你可以选择最合适的开发方式,让你的项目顺利进行。